Medicare and exclusive health insurance will certainly cover cataract surgical treatment offered that it's regarded clinically essential. Nonetheless, clients will need to pay an insurance deductible and also copays.

The amount of the yearly insurance deductible as well as copayment requirements will vary depending on your personal insurance plan selections. The cataract surgery price will certainly additionally vary depending upon the type of lens you pick.




Depending on what sort of lens you choose, where you get surgical treatment and exactly how the procedure is performed, your cataract surgery cost will certainly vary. A lot of Medicare Advantage plans include cataract surgery, and several private medical insurance strategies do also.

Throughout cataract surgery, medical professionals get rid of the all-natural lens from the eye with a little cut (laceration) in the cornea. The surgeon can use 2 traditional surgical techniques: phacoemulsification (phaco) as well as extracapsular cataract extraction (ECE).

Both surgeries are minimally intrusive. They begin with the doctor providing eyedrops and also a shot of anesthesia to stop pain and ensure you're not awake throughout the procedure. The cosmetic surgeon after that uses a microscope to watch the cataract as well as develops a small laceration. Costs lenses, like those that deal with for astigmatism or remove the requirement for glasses or contact lenses, aren't covered by Medicare since they're thought about optional as opposed to clinically necessary.

Prices Connected With Choosing a Surgical Center


Medicare and also exclusive health insurance usually cover conventional cataract surgical procedure, but the specifics of an individual's protection may differ. For instance, an individual with Medicare may need to fulfill a vision examination limit before cataracts are considered serious enough for the treatment to be covered. A person with private insurance coverage may need to pay an insurance deductible or copayment for the treatment.

Individuals ought to also consider how much the cosmetic surgeon's facility fee will set you back, which can differ depending upon where a person has their surgical treatment performed. For example, an ambulatory surgical center (ASC) is generally less costly than a health center outpatient division.

People ought to ask their eye doctor whether their insurance policy strategy covers two surgeries per eye, which can save on costs. They ought to additionally speak to their eye doctor about layaway plan and also see if they can utilize funds from versatile spending accounts or health savings accounts to aid pay for the procedure. These alternatives can assist make cataract surgical procedure much more budget-friendly.

Your surgeon may use a range of IOLs, consisting of basic monofocal lenses, multifocal IOLs, or toric IOLs that fix astigmatism. You can review the options with your eye doctor to figure out which would best match your requirements.


Cataract surgical procedure is widely considered to be clinically needed by private health insurance and also Medicare (components A & B). In most cases, these plans cover most of expenditures after the annual insurance deductible has actually been met.

It is very important to discuss all of the expenses related to cataract surgical procedure freely with your specialist.
